Sounds as if you are low on freon.An R-22 evaporator running at 40F saturation temperature will have a corresponding pressure of 68.5 psig. Should the suction pressure drop below 57 psig, the coil temperature will drop below 32F causing moisture in the air to freeze on it (see Figure 4) causing no end of trouble. Consider the refrigerant R-410A: the pressure in the evaporator is 93.2 psia, according to the Table 8 (ASHRAE, 2013). The pressure value is used to find the saturation temperature.

These line sizing charts are based on a suction pressure drop equivalent to a 2°F change in saturation pressure and liquid line pressure drop of 5 psi. For R-404A Low Temperature 1 psi; for R-404A and R-22 Medium Temperature 2 psi is used. This is the maximum allowable pressure drop for the entire piping run regardless if it is 50' or 250'.

When operated at a 35 degC ambient temperature, the suction pressure of an Air-Conditioner with R410A refrigerants ranges from 115 to 125 Psig. At these operating conditions, the discharge pressure is around 400 Psig. R-410A operates at 50 to 70% higher pressures than the R-22. Checking ...Jan 7, 2019 · SUCTION PRESSURE / EVAP DTD RULE OF THUMB Another common old school rule of thumb is suction pressure should be close to the outdoor temperature in a R-22 system. However, this rule of thumb (obviously) does not work on an R-410A system. A more applicable guideline is 20˚-25˚ suction saturation below outdoor ambient.
